Thanks for the quick replies.

In the initial version of this (small) project, only the global status (colour) is of interest. An idea for a next version is to encode the 'life time' of the current status roughly in the blinking frequency of the traffic light. In this case the 'life time' will be defined as the time elapsed since the (currently) last test entering the current colour state. The latter function is almost certain not doable within the limited resources of the micro controller.

As for the initial version: trying to retrieve the global status on such a small machine (probably using a regular expression to find and extract the state) is part of the fun. The non-green page will probably be the shortest of the pages which contain the global status of Xymon and thus the best candidate for retrieval of the status.
